Output e7014beddabfa0d882149bb04fc767ae2e0f42a14f9a953467601e894c78a046:50

value
240325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d829f43ca09a96b58d17f763248771dbe09d57f9 OP_EQUAL
address
3MPz8zpH4wfppdHyrMRFRGVxPHm3suMtyL
transaction
e7014beddabfa0d882149bb04fc767ae2e0f42a14f9a953467601e894c78a046